Hello, for some odd reason, parse_url returns the host (ex. example.com) as the path when no scheme is provided in the input url. So I've written a quick function to get the real host:

<?php
function getHost($Address) {
$parseUrl = parse_url(trim($Address));
return
trim($parseUrl[host] ? $parseUrl[host] : array_shift(explode('/', $parseUrl[path], 2)));
}

getHost("example.com"); // Gives example.com
getHost("http://example.com"); // Gives example.com
getHost("www.example.com"); // Gives www.example.com
getHost("http://example.com/xyz"); // Gives example.com
?>

You could try anything! It gives the host (including the subdomain if exists).
